Description

  • This brass body padlock features a solid brass lock body and a hardened alloy steel shackle coated with NANO PROTECT™ for high corrosion resistance. It is equipped with a 6-pin tumbler cylinder with rust-free components and anti-pick mushroom pins to enhance security. The lock can be keyed alike with other locks of the same reference or master-keyed upon request. It is suitable for securing gates, lockers, storage units, and other applications requiring reliable padlocks.

Specifications

  • Security Level: 8
  • Key type: Keyed alike (same key for multiple locks) or master-keyed (upon request)
  • Shackle width: 23.5mm
  • Shackle height: 25mm
  • Shackle diameter: 8mm
  • Overall width: 47mm
  • Overall height: 85mm
  • Overall depth: 21mm

ABUS, an acronym for August Bremicker und Söhne KG, is a German company specialising in security equipment (mainly padlocks, anti-theft devices and locks). Since its foundation in 1924 in Volmarstein in the Ruhr by August Bremicker, the company has specialised in padlocks: its first model, the IRON ROCK, was designed in the attic of the family home. Bremicker then used solid brass, which was lighter but just as strong as steel, revolutionising the padlock industry. In 1949, it was the famous DISKUS padlock that became the benchmark for padlocks to this day, such was its revolutionary design. But the most successful padlocks were the Granit padlocks. In 1971, it developed the first anti-theft bicycle locks. ABUS has remained a family business, with the fourth generation at the helm. It has diversified into bicycle locks, container locks, marine engine locks, HOMETEC electronic door locks, etc.
